Abstract
A new Optical Resilient Packet Ring buffer model was introduced in this paper, end-to-end delay of packet in Optical Resilient Packet Ring was analyzed. The computing equation for end-to-end average delay of packet with different service priority was proposed,while fiber-delay-lines acting as transfer buffer at node.The relationship between delay and traffic, fiber delay lines unit length is analyzed via the equation.
